Orbital augmentation is a surgical procedure designed to enhance the anatomy of the orbit, the bony cavity that contains the eyeball and its supporting structures. This intervention is primarily indicated for patients with conditions such as traumatic injuries, congenital deformities, or certain medical disorders that lead to orbital volume loss or deformity. The cause of orbital augmentation may include a variety of factors, such as trauma resulting from accidents or sports injuries that compromise the integrity of the orbital bones, congenital anomalies like hypotropia, or orbital tumors that necessitate resection and reconstruction. Furthermore, it can be employed in reconstructive surgery following conditions like thyroid eye disease, which can lead to abnormal tissue expansion, resulting in bulging eyes or asymmetrical appearances. The procedure aims to restore normal orbital contour and volume to improve both aesthetic outcomes and ocular function. Patients typically present with a range of symptoms that may include visible displacement of the eyeball, an eye that appears protruded or bulging (a condition known as exophthalmos), diplopia or double vision due to misalignment of the eyes, discomfort, and in more severe cases, impaired vision or the sensation of pressure in the ocular region. Prior to surgery, a meticulous assessment through imaging studies like CT scans or MRIs is essential to delineate the extent of orbital involvement and to plan an effective surgical approach. Surgical techniques often involve the use of biomaterials or autologous (self-donated) tissues to augment the orbital volume. Common materials include hydroxyapatite, silicone, or polymethylmethacrylate, which can be molded to fit the specific requirements of the patient's anatomy. The procedure requires a high degree of skill and precision, as the orbital area is situated near critical structures such as the optic nerve and the associated vasculature. Post-operative care is vital for monitoring any potential complications such as infection, hematoma formation, or changes in eye movement. The recovery phase may involve the use of medications to manage discomfort and to minimize the risk of infection, along with follow-up appointments to assess healing and any necessary adjustments. Long-term results can significantly improve the patient's quality of life, addressing both functional impairments and aesthetic concerns, and restoring confidence in their appearance. Ultimately, orbital augmentation represents a complex interplay between anatomy, surgical intervention, and rehabilitative care that underscores the need for a multidisciplinary approach to achieve optimal outcomes for individuals affected by orbital abnormalities.
